HARTFORD, CONNECTICUT โ€” In recent years, Connecticut has emerged as a hub for innovative therapy practices, spearheading the integration of virtual reality (VR) technology into PTSD treatment protocols. This cutting-edge approach aims to provide patients with immersive therapeutic experiences that significantly aid in trauma processing and emotional healing. As mental health professionals seek enhanced tools to treat complex disorders, VR offers a promising avenue that could transform traditional therapeutic modalities.

The University of Connecticut, a leading institution in this endeavor, has been at the forefront of research into VR therapy for PTSD patients. Their notable initiatives at the Center for Trauma Recovery and Innovation focus on crafting virtual environments that allow patients to safely engage with traumatic memories in a controlled setting. By using VR headsets, patients are able to enter these tailored environments where therapists guide them through revisiting and reframing traumatic experiences (UConn Health News). This method helps in reducing the distress linked with PTSD, promoting faster recovery and improved mental health outcomes.

What's new in this field is not just the increasing effectiveness of VR-based therapy, but also its accessibility. New Haven's Veterans Affairs Medical Center has recently expanded its program to include VR sessions for veterans dealing with PTSD. This expansion extends the reach of VR therapy beyond traditional clinical settings, opening doors for a broader demographic of patients who may benefit from virtual treatment methods. The integration of VR technology allows for highly interactive and personalized therapy sessions which can be adapted to address specific traumas and triggers unique to each individual (New Haven Independent).

Conversely, some clinicians remain cautious about the widespread adoption of VR therapy, citing concerns over the novelty of the technology and the necessity for comprehensive long-term studies to fully ascertain its efficacy. Critics argue that while VR shows promise, mental health care should not shift away from time-tested therapy models too swiftly (Journal of Anxiety Disorders). These professionals advocate for a balanced approach, integrating VR therapy as a complementary rather than a replacement strategy within the broader therapeutic framework.
